探索Nuxtjs构建更好的Vue应用

北京中科白癜风医院 http://finance.sina.com.cn/chanjing/b/20090930/09073071708.shtml

你是Vue.js的爱好者吗?你是否已经尝试了Nuxt.js,这个强大的基于Vue.js的框架?今天,我们要一起探索Nuxt.js,看看它能为你的Vue.js应用带来什么。

Nuxt.js是一个基于Vue.js的服务器端渲染(SSR)框架,用于构建更强大、更优雅的Vue.js应用。与基于客户端的单页面应用(SPA)相比,服务器端渲染的优势在于:更好的SEO:由于搜索引擎爬虫更容易读取服务器渲染的页面,因此SSR可以更好地提升SEO效果。更快的内容到达时间:服务器端渲染的页面可以更早地将内容展示给用户,提升用户体验。但Nuxt.js不仅仅是一个服务器端渲染框架,它还提供了许多其他强大的特性:自动生成路由配置:你只需要根据约定在pages目录下创建文件,Nuxt.js就能自动为你生成对应的路由配置。强大的插件系统:你可以使用插件来定制Nuxt.js的功能,或者将你的代码集成到Nuxt.js的核心流程中。内置Webpack配置:Nuxt.js内置了优化过的Webpack配置,你无需自己进行复杂的配置。为了开始使用Nuxt.js,你可以安装Nuxt.js的命令行工具,然后使用create-nuxt-app命令来创建一个新的Nuxt.js应用。虽然Nuxt.js在一些方面增加了复杂性,例如你需要处理服务器端和客户端代码的区别,但它也提供了很多帮助你处理这些复杂性的工具和约定。如果你已经喜欢上了Vue.js,那么Nuxt.js绝对值得你去尝试。有了Nuxt.js,你可以更好地构建你的Vue.js应用,无论你是在构建一个小型的个人项目,还是一个需要承载大量流量的大型网站。#VUE#


转载请注明:http://www.aierlanlan.com/cyrz/8959.html

  • 上一篇文章:
  •   
  • 下一篇文章: